by alkali leaching of a commercially available crystalline Ni-Al alloy[7-9]. Meanwhile, Ni can improve Al and its alloys’ high temperature strength and stability in dimension, and Ni can reduce the hazardous effects of Fe in Al alloys. In general, Ni is added to Al alloys in the form of Al-Ni master alloys. So Al-Ni master alloy is very important material. Metal nickel has useful bulk properties......
